Action item from the Brightmoor Clinic reminder outage: the nightly reminder job silently skipped patients when the batch window overran. As the contractor picking this up, your task is to add overrun detection and alerting, and to split the batch into smaller chunks with checkpointing so a restart resumes cleanly. Do not change the send logic itself — only the scheduling wrapper. The batch sizing and timeout values we agreed on in the review are listed below.

constants for fajop-tahaf:
RATE_LIMITS = {
    "holael": 2,
    "oliael": 10,
    "druael": 10,
    "wenwyn": 10,
}

To the board: quick update on the large-deal discount question. We've been stretching past the 20% guardrail on anything above the Kestrel tier, and it's starting to show in blended margins. Proposal on the table: cap discretionary discounts at 15%, with anything beyond that needing sign-off from the pricing committee chaired by Fenna Ulrecht. Sales grumbled, predictably, but the pipeline modelling suggests minimal churn risk. We'd like a nod at Thursday's session. The rationale tied to next year's plans appears below.

confidential, kagup-bafog: Fraaxax Group is in early talks to buy Soroxox Group for about $343.8 million. The Olidor launch date is June 14, and nothing goes to the press before then. Legal wants the Aldmirek Logistics term sheet signed before July 23.

### Changed defaults — dependency pinning

Heads up, reviewers: Lanternbox now pins all transitive deps by default instead of floating minor versions. Builds got way more reproducible, and the weekly "surprise breakage" tickets basically stopped. Opt-outs need a written justification in the PR description. The new default configuration values shipped with this release are as follows.

service settings:
[casax]
port = 6379
team = rusir
host = casax.zemvarhq.corp
region = outer-4
access_code = ac_9808ce
timeout_ms = 1500